Harriette Smythies, also known as Mrs. Gordon Smythies, was an English writer. She was born Harriet Maria Gordon in 1813 and lived until 1883. Harriette wrote many books, including novels and poems. She published about 20 books between 1838 and 1875.

Her Early Life

Harriette Smythies was born in Margate, Kent, England. She came from an important military family. Her parents were Jane Gordon and Edward Lesmoir Gordon. Her father was a Sergeant-at-Arms.

Harriette had four brothers and sisters. One of her sisters, named Jane, was known for giving money to good causes. Her brother, Edward, also became a Sergeant-at-Arms. He served at the special ceremony where Queen Victoria became queen in 1838.

Her Family and Writing

Harriette married Reverend William Yorick Smythies. She wrote many books, mostly novels. Her books were published by well-known companies like Richard Bentley and Hurst and Blackett. Sometimes, her books were published under the name "Mrs. Gordon Smythies."

Her stories often explored themes of love and marriage. Harriette was a very busy writer, publishing many books throughout her life.

Later Years

In 1871, Harriette's sister Jane passed away. Jane left most of her money to charity. Harriette lived separately from her husband for many years. She continued to write until her death in 1883.

Harriette and William had one child, a son named William Gordon Smythies. He became a lawyer and also a writer, just like his mother.
